Iron Man Thorbuster Suit

Defend the table deck that can still have a player phase. Defend for yourself and the table with Defiance, Preemptive Strike and Cuts Both Ways. Convert damage taken into damage and threat removal with Energy Barrier and Ops Room. Then activate with your hero and suit upgrades in player phase. 23 in the deck for that Thor effect and big damage on Repulsor Blast.

Automated Defense

Defend without exhausting thanks to Cuts Both Ways, Defiance, and Preemptive Strike. Preemptive Strike and Cuts Both Ways can pull attacks to you so you can protect others. Can use our basic defense to protect other players if we do not have the defense events. Defiance and Preemptive Strike eliminate the boost icons so you're only taking the Villain's base attack. Energy Barrier and Ops Room prevent that damage, converting the damage to damage output and threat removal. Although the deck defends the table and has damage prevention, it isn't a perfect defense deck. Angel's Aerie accumulates tokens for each defense card you play or basic defense you make. Angel's Aerie can help get us back to full health. Down Time helps to increase our healing factor for stronger scenarios.

Thwart Management

Mark V Helmet and Iron Man's basic thwart for 2 is great for thwarting the table. Arc Reactor to ready for extra thwarts. Ops Room also provides thwarting through our defense.

Damage Buster

Powered Gauntlets deal 4 damage a turn. Energy Barrier is a recurring source of damage. The big damage is Repulsor Blast and Supersonic Punch. Repulsor Blast will regularly see +4 icons in the discard.

Resources Galore

On top of reaching 7 hand size, Unflappable, Change of Fortune, Ingenuity, Quincarrier, Pepper Potts provide a ton of card draw and resources. We will flip to AE at times for the Stark Tower recursion of tech upgrades.

Notes

Deck Cycle. We go through the deck incredibly quickly. It's good for seeing our key cards regularly. We don't need Stark Tower recursion when we can draw 7-9+ cards a turn. We thin our deck out anyway with so much board. Repulsor Blast mills through the deck. We burn through the deck and get extra encounter cards regularly. However, the positive output is strong. Can handle quite a lot of tempo.

Density. The defend without exhausting is good and fun. Cuts Both Ways is a great card in this deck. The retaliate value from each instance stacks up in multiplayer. Desperate Defense is a good substitute. Desperate Defense keeps us ready and can preserve our damage prevention cards better than Cuts Both Ways.
